The late-night snacks at City Market are solid - Review - Seattle - The Infatuation

"Want to admire a life-sized statue of the Predator, get a pair of cheap sunglasses, and order a filling late-night meal? You’ve come to the right place. This little store is at the nexus of the universe, or at least a few blocks from major highways and Capitol Hill bars. Meaning it’s perfect for grabbing something to-go at the deli counter before getting back on the road. A majority of the decent food lineup is made to order and nothing feels more triumphant than stumbling down East Olive Way with a hefty, greasy bag of fried things after a few Manny’s. Flavor comes second on nights like these. Food Rundown Fried Chicken The pieces are chunky with a decent crisp, but they need more salt. Pizza Bites These are basically like Hot Pockets with a fried, toasty exterior, but without the third-degree mouth burns. Inside is a satisfying ratio of sauce to cheese, and you’re going to want to order a few bags so you don’t have to share. Jojos The wedges are massive, but the largest ones are missing crunch and there’s not much to them unless you dredge them in dips. Crispitos They’re huge and have a shell that shatters like a life-sized Jenga game—we just wish the filling wasn’t so shy (it’s really tucked in there)." - Gabe Guarente
